Overview Rabise D 10mg/20mg Tablet
G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D), or acid reflux, can be treated with the combined medication, Rabise D 10mg/20mg Tablet. This medication alleviates symptoms like heartburn, stomach upset, and irritation by neutralizing stomach acid and facilitating gas expulsion. Rabise D 10mg/20mg Tablets should be taken on an empty stomach, following your doctor's prescribed dosage and schedule. Treatment duration depends on individual response and condition. Premature discontinuation may lead to symptom recurrence and disease exacerbation. Inform your healthcare provider of all other medications you're using, as interactions are possible. Common side effects, such as diarrhea, abdominal pain, dry mouth, headache, gas, and fatigue, are generally transient. Report any concerning side effects immediately. Drowsiness and dizziness are potential side effects; avoid driving or activities requiring alertness until the medication's effects are known. Alcohol consumption should be avoided due to potential increased drowsiness. Lifestyle adjustments, including consuming cool milk and avoiding hot beverages, spicy foods, and chocolate, can enhance treatment outcomes. Prior to commencing treatment, disclose any kidney or liver conditions, as well as pregnancy, pregnancy plans, or breastfeeding, to your physician.

How Rabise D 10mg/20mg Tablet works:
Rabise D, a 10mg/20mg combination tablet containing Domperidone and Rabeprazole, offers dual action for digestive relief. Domperidone, a prokinetic agent, enhances gastrointestinal motility, facilitating smoother food passage. Rabeprazole, a proton pump inhibitor (PPI), diminishes stomach acid production, providing symptomatic relief from heartburn and acid indigestion.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CAUTION
Exercise caution when combining alcohol and Rabise D 10mg/20mg tablets. Seek medical advice before doing so.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Rabise D 10mg/20mg Tablet during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to a f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ible dangers pr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Use of Rabise D 10mg/20mg tablets while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ates potential trans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ving should be avoided if taking Rabise D 10mg/20mg Tablets, as this medication can cause drowsiness, blurred vision, and dizziness, reducing alertness.
KidneyCAUTION
Individuals with kidney impairment should use Rabise D 10mg/20mg tablets cautiously. Dosage modification of Rabise D 10mg/20mg tablets may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CAUTION
Individuals with liver impairment should exercise caution when using Rabise D 10mg/20mg tablets, as dosage modification may be necessary. Medical advice is recommended. Rabise D 10mg/20mg tablets are contraindicated for patients exhibiting moderate to severe hepatic dysfunction.
